The Aggies' softball team has announced the signing of four players in its 2015-16 class with Bailey Lewis (Loomis, Calif.), Mia Maher (Irvine, Calif.), Katie Schroeder (Camas, Wash.) and Bailee Trapp (Tremonton, Utah) all signing National Letters of Intent.

Trapp, from nearby Bear River H.S., is a pitcher and third baseman who learned all-region honors every season of her high school career. She had a batting average of .450 and a fielding percentage of .968 during her club career.

Lewis was a four-year varsity starter as a catcher and helped her club team win two Sacramento Metro titles. Maher, an outfielder, had a .429 batting average and .471 on base percentage and led her high school conference as a junior with 33 stolen bases. Schroeder is a pitcher who was her league's Player of the Year as a junior.
